Take the initiative.

It goes without saying, but getting away from your ordinary life every once in a while is a pretty good idea. I feel this quite strongly with Japan, at least Yamagata, because there is a set of understandings that aren't really tested until people leave and see a completely different point of view. Some of the people I know are actually scared of going overseas, it's hard to know exactly why this fear exists, but the fact it does is a problem.

Either way, getting away from your everyday life every once in a while gives you perspective that you can very much use in your life. The thing is, you have to have the balls to lead the change when necessary. Take the initiative to lead when things can be different. Other people will react to your actions, meaning you have made them think if just for a bit.
